document.write( "Question 192723: One common use of positive and negative exponents is in writing numbers as scientific notation. For example 0.000052 can be written as 5.2 × 10-5. A) Use scientific notation and the laws of exponents to evaluate (0.000048)(0.0000035)(0.00014). Leave your answer in scientific notation. B) If a space probe travels at 100 kilometers per second for 12 years, how far will it travel? Write your answer in scientific notation. (Assume 1 year = 365 days)\r
